Location Intelligence and Market Navigation

Understanding geography is fundamental to navigating Seychelles property markets. Each island has a distinct economic role, infrastructure profile, and development density, which directly influences property pricing and investment suitability.

Mahé remains the central hub, offering the highest concentration of infrastructure, employment, and residential development. It is typically the starting point for most international buyer journeys.

In contrast, Praslin and La Digue offer more lifestyle-driven environments with lower density and stronger environmental appeal, making them suitable for different investment objectives.

Seychelles Property Market Comparison by Key Regions (2026)

Region Typical Property Types Market Price Profile Market Character
Mahe Luxury villas, beachfront apartments, hillside homes, short-let investment properties Premium tier
~USD 350K - 5M+
Main island and economic hub of Seychelles, combining tourism, government, and residential demand. Strong liquidity in prime coastal areas, with consistent short-term rental demand driven by international tourism and expat relocation.
Praslin Beach villas, boutique residences, holiday apartments, eco-luxury homes ~USD 300K - 3M+ Second-largest inhabited island with a strong eco-tourism identity. Limited supply supports price stability, with strong appeal for lifestyle buyers and boutique rental operators targeting premium holiday guests.
La Digue Guesthouses, small villas, eco-lodges, boutique tourism properties ~USD 250K - 2M+ Low-density island with a strong conservation ethos and minimal vehicle infrastructure. Highly restricted supply creates niche investment opportunities focused on boutique tourism and slow-luxury hospitality.
Beau Vallon Beachfront apartments, holiday rentals, hospitality-linked residences ~USD 400K - 4M+ Most active beach tourism zone on Mahe with strong rental performance. High occupancy driven by hotels, restaurants, and water sports tourism. One of the most liquid short-term rental micro-markets.
Baie Lazare Luxury villas, hillside homes, boutique resort residences ~USD 500K - 6M+ Upscale southwest Mahe region known for privacy, scenic coastline, and luxury villa developments. Attractive for high-net-worth buyers seeking exclusivity and low-density residential living.
Cote d'Or (Praslin) Beach villas, resort apartments, short-let investment units ~USD 350K - 3.5M+ Key tourism beach strip on Praslin with strong seasonal rental demand. Close proximity to hotels and marine activities supports consistent occupancy and tourism-driven yields.
Baie Sainte Anne Residential homes, marina-adjacent villas, rental apartments ~USD 300K - 2.5M+ Primary administrative and port area of Praslin. Balanced market with both local housing demand and tourism spillover from nearby coastal attractions.
Eden Island Marina apartments, waterfront villas, luxury gated residences ~USD 600K - 8M+ One of Seychelles' most exclusive master-planned developments. Strong international buyer base, marina access, and high-end rental demand make it a premier investment enclave.
Silhouette Island Eco-resort properties, luxury hotel-linked villas ~USD 1M - 10M+ Highly protected island with extremely limited private ownership opportunities. Dominated by conservation and ultra-luxury eco-tourism operations.
North Island Ultra-luxury private villas, resort-only estates ~USD 5M - 20M+ One of the most exclusive private island developments in the Indian Ocean. Ultra-high-net-worth buyers, privacy-focused ownership, and world-class eco-luxury positioning.
Fregate Island Private estate villas, conservation-led luxury residences ~USD 5M - 25M+ Ultra-private island combining conservation, luxury hospitality, and extremely limited residence opportunities. Strong appeal for legacy asset ownership.
Desroches Island Resort villas, branded residences, island retreat properties ~USD 2M - 15M+ Outer island with strong resort branding and experiential tourism focus. Investment driven by luxury hospitality operators and high-end holiday rental demand.

The Seychelles property market is highly segmented between mainstream residential hubs on Mahe and Praslin and ultra-exclusive private island assets. Mahe and Beau Vallon dominate liquidity and short-term rental demand, while Praslin offers a more relaxed eco-luxury investment profile. Islands such as Eden Island provide structured marina-led luxury living, whereas outer private islands like North, Fregate, and Desroches represent ultra-high-net-worth trophy assets with limited supply and strong conservation-driven value preservation.

Regulatory Environment and Market Access

Regulation plays a central role in shaping Seychelles property transactions. Foreign ownership rules, environmental protections, and development approvals all influence how and where international buyers can participate in the market.

Guides help clarify these frameworks, ensuring buyers understand both opportunities and constraints before committing capital.

This is particularly relevant in high-value or environmentally sensitive areas, where additional approval layers may apply.
